Media Statement from Western Cape
Media Centre 29 April 2014 A 27 year old female from Grassy Park was caught red-handed in the early hours of Saturday morning (2014-04-27) while busy wrapping smaller plastic bags of tik with an estimated street value of R100 000-00. The arrest follows after the SAPS members received information concerning drugs being sold from a residence in the Ottery Flats in Ottery. Just after midnight the members immediately executed a search operation at the premises and found the 27 year old female, still busy packing smaller packets of tik inside the flat. The police members found small packets of tik and an undisclosed amount of cash. They also seized a scale, a sealer and about 900 empty small plastic packets. The female suspect was arrested on charges of dealing, alternatively possession of drugs. The suspect will appear in the Wynberg Magistrates' Court today (2014-04-29). In another unrelated success on Friday (2014-04-25) morning around 05:00, SAPS members from Laaiplek police station and members from the West Coast K9 (Dog) Unit arrested five people for possession of ammunition. The suspects, two males aged 24 and 32 and three females aged 19, 20 and 27 were arrested at a house in Heide Street, Noordhoek in possession of 13 x 9mm ammunition rounds and one gram of tik, and an undisclosed amount of cash. The suspects will appear in the Saldanha Court today (2014-04-29) on charges of possession of ammunition and drugs. -End- Media Enquiries: Constable
